This worksheet has been designed to allow your students to identify important activities in their week and create their own schedule for each day.
Sequence days of the week and times of the day including morning, lunchtime, afternoon and night time, and connect them to familiar events and actions
Compare and order duration of events using everyday language of time
Connect days of the week to familiar events and actions
Describes mathematical situations using everyday language, actions, materials and informal recordings
Sequences events, uses everyday language to describe the durations of events, and reads hour time on clocks
Sequences events and reads hour time on clocks
Allow students to copy a modelled version that highlights shared activities e.g. specialist subject day etc.
Students complete independently and identify more than 1 activity for each day.
